Open-Ended Coaxial Line Probes With Negative Permittivity Materials
IEEE Transactions on Antennas and Propagation, 2011This work presents analysis of the behavior of open-ended coaxial near-field probes in the presence of e-negative material. The effect of using negative material layers on the sensitivity is studied. It is shown that optimal conditions related to the thickness and constitutive parameters of the negative medium give rise to significant enhancement in ...

Evaluation of modelling routines for on-line implementation of the open-ended coaxial probe
Measurement Science and Technology, 1998Three different models giving the relationship between the complex reflection coefficient and the complex permittivity have been evaluated for use with an open-ended coaxial probe in an on-line measurement system: Cole's bilinear model (model 1) and the more sophisticated models of Marsland and Evans (model 2) and Marcuvitz (model 3).
